Researcher – Lean 4 & Formal Proof Systems (AI Training)

About The Role

What if your mathematical expertise could directly shape how AI reasons about proofs — pushing the boundary of what machines can understand and verify? We’re looking for mathematicians and formal verification specialists to translate sophisticated human‑written arguments into precise, machine‑checkable Lean 4 proofs for cutting‑edge AI research. This is a fully remote, flexible contract role designed for researchers who thrive on rigor, structure, and working at the frontier of mechanized mathematics.

  • Organization: Alignerr
  • Type: Hourly Contract
  • Location: Remote
  • Commitment: 10–40 hours/week

What You’ll Do

  • Translate informal mathematical proofs into Lean 4 (and related proof systems) with an emphasis on clarity, correctness, and structural elegance
  • Analyze domain‑specific proofs to identify gaps, hidden assumptions, and formalizable sub‑structures
  • Construct formalizations that probe the limits of existing proof assistants — especially where automation breaks down
  • Collaborate with AI researchers to design, refine, and evaluate strategies for improving formal verification pipelines
  • Develop readable, reproducible proof scripts aligned with mathematical best practices and proof assistant idioms
  • Provide expert guidance on proof decomposition, lemma selection, and structuring techniques for formal models
  • Investigate where automated provers fail and articulate why — complexity, missing lemmas, insufficient libraries, or structural issues
  • Create Lean proofs that surface deeper patterns or generalizations implicit in the original mathematics

Who You Are

  • Master’s degree or higher in Mathematics, Logic, Theoretical Computer Science, or a closely related field
  • Strong foundation in rigorous proof writing across areas such as algebra, analysis, topology, logic, or discrete mathematics
  • Hands‑on experience with Lean (Lean 3 or Lean 4), Coq, Isabelle/HOL, Agda, or comparable formal systems — Lean 4 strongly preferred
  • Able to translate informal mathematical arguments into clean, structured formal proofs
  • Deep enthusiasm for formal verification, proof assistants, and the future of mechanized mathematics
